Neil Wagner put the pain of his fractured toes behind him to help the Black Caps to a thrilling win over Pakistan late on the final day of the first test at Bay Oval in Mount Maunganui.
The tireless left-armer, birthday boy Kyle Jamieson, and left-arm spinner Mitchell Santner took crucial wickets in the final session on Wednesday to help secure a 101-run win with 4.3 overs to spare that provisionally moved the Black Caps to No 1 on the ICC rankings and kept their hopes of making the World Test Championship…
